โœฆ Synopsis


This paper advances a new method which can correct the spectrum peak value of the rms spectrum in order to decrease the errors that exist when the spectral line is not on the peak. The authors first use the barycentre of spectral lines in the main lobe to obtain the coordinate of the spectrum peak. By this means the accurate frequency, amplitude and phase of the spectrum peak are obtained.
